Output bf039e144e5e63cf48315dff97c0a90eb578c1f93b56222f47a6fac70aea66ad:93

value
3500381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a250e091cbe24457d80caefc965be685783226 OP_EQUAL
address
3Bxa3wJXKmSXxbrGCL7BmuTFbPcprj8AM8
transaction
bf039e144e5e63cf48315dff97c0a90eb578c1f93b56222f47a6fac70aea66ad
spent
false

2 Sat Ranges